One of the most popular methods of prenatal DNA testing is non-invasive prenatal testing (NIPT) This test analyzes cell-free fetal DNA (cffDNA) that is circulating in the mother’s blood NIPT is commonly used to screen for chromosomal abnormalities such as Down syndrome, trisomy 18, and trisomy 13 It can also determine the sex of the baby and identify certain genetic conditions NIPT is a safe and non-invasive procedure that can be performed as early as the 10th week of pregnancy While NIPT can be more expensive than traditional screening tests, there are now more affordable options available, making it accessible to more families.

In addition to NIPT and paternity testing, there are other affordable options for prenatal DNA testing, such as genetic carrier screening This type of test can help identify if the parents are carriers of certain genetic mutations that could be passed on to their baby Carrier screening is particularly important for couples with a family history of genetic disorders, such as cystic fibrosis, sickle cell anemia, or Tay-Sachs disease By identifying these genetic mutations early on, parents can make informed decisions about their pregnancy and plan for any necessary medical interventions.
